Condition: Cardiopulmonary Bypass · AKI - Acute Kidney Injury · Sponsor: Ain Shams University
The aim of the planned study is to assess the prophylactic effect of intraoperative administration of a single dose of methylprednisolone 2 (mg/kg) in decreasing the incidence of postoperative acute kidney injury after cardiac surgeries with cardiopulmonary bypass.
